The Dance of Love and Heartbreak: Dissecting Tory Lanez's 'The Color Violet'

Tory Lanez's 'The Color Violet' is a poignant exploration of love, heartbreak, and the internal conflict of a playboy persona. The song delves into the complexities of a romantic encounter that is both thrilling and destructive. Lanez's lyrics paint a vivid picture of a fleeting relationship, marked by a fast-paced lifestyle and the allure of materialism. The mention of a 'Barbie' and the 'X on the dot' suggests a superficial connection, one that is perhaps more about image and instant gratification than genuine affection. The protagonist's admission of being a loner, despite the woman's interest in his 'watch,' 'drop-top,' and 'persona,' indicates a guarded nature and a reluctance to fully engage emotionally.

The chorus of 'The Color Violet' captures the essence of a man who has been hurt by love. The metaphor of a 'speeding car going ninety in the rain' symbolizes the reckless abandon with which he has approached relationships, leading to inevitable pain. The repeated line 'playboys, we don't dance, dance, dance' serves as a mantra for the protagonist's resistance to the vulnerability that comes with romance. The dance here is a metaphor for the emotional give-and-take of a relationship, which the protagonist is hesitant to partake in due to past experiences of heartbreak.

Lanez's musical style, often characterized by its blend of R&B and hip-hop, provides the perfect backdrop for the song's introspective lyrics. The smooth, melodic beats juxtaposed with the raw emotion of the lyrics create a tension that mirrors the conflict within the protagonist. 'The Color Violet' is not just a narrative about a specific encounter; it's a broader commentary on the challenges of maintaining a playboy image while yearning for real connection. The song resonates with anyone who has ever grappled with the desire to love and the fear of getting too close, making it a relatable anthem for the guarded hearts.
